Selwyn College was the first Hall of Residence established at New Zealand’s oldest university. The prestigious college cherishes its unique and rich heritage that goes back many generations and reflects its core values of inclusiveness and mutual respect and care.

Selwyn College began as a Theological Residential Hall at Otago University way back in 1893. It was a male only college until 1983 when females were finally admitted. Girls now comprise approximately 50% of the students based there. read more
